Output fa49d545977a043485e0e0e234b5b51dfa26c750c2e8b98c273f4576a84441ec:3

value
656939850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dd41cf4bfe66a97286b0c68c248461a88f4c546 OP_EQUAL
address
3AF8sG6xfW8TahPq4eSaecenUqCg4BcpFR
transaction
fa49d545977a043485e0e0e234b5b51dfa26c750c2e8b98c273f4576a84441ec
confirmations
302700
spent
true